Figure 3: Structure of JNK1 in complex with MKP7-CD.

(a) Ribbon diagram of JNK1–MKP7-CD complex in two views related by a 45° rotation around a vertical axis. (b) Structure of MKP7-CD with its active site highlight in cyan. The 2Fo−Fc omit map (contoured at 1.5σ) for the P-loop of MKP7-CD is shown at inset of b. (c) Structure of VHR with its active site highlighted in marine blue. (d) Close-up view of the JNK1–MKP7 interface showing interacting amino acids of JNK1 (orange) and MKP7-CD (cyan). The JNK1 is shown in surface representation coloured according to electrostatic potential (positive, blue; negative, red). (e) Interaction networks mainly involving helices α4 and α5 from MKP7-CD, and αG and α2L14 of JNK1. MKP7-CD is shown in surface representation coloured according to electrostatic potential (positive, blue; negative, red). Blue dashed lines represent polar interactions. (f) The 2Fo−Fc omit map (contoured at 1.5σ) clearly shows electron density for the 285FNFL288 segment of MKP7-CD.
